Birmingham, Ala. – Shin Oh, M.D., professor of neurology and pathology and director of the Division of Neuromuscular Disease in the Department of Neurology at UAB (University of Alabama at Birmingham) has been designated a distinguished professor, by action Feb. 2 of the Board of Trustees of the University of Alabama System.

Oh, also director of the muscle/nerve histopathology laboratory at UAB Hospital, is the author of four textbooks related to the diagnosis of neuromuscular disease. He is an internationally known clinician, researcher and educator. He also is the recipient of the Distinguished Researcher Award for 2006 from the American Association of Neuromuscular and Electrodiagnostic Medicine.

Oh joined the UAB faculty in 1970 after earning his medical degree from Seoul National University in Seoul, Korea, and completing residency training in Korea and at Georgetown University Hospital in Washington, D.C.
